    Fifth Of VW Workers Could Use CARTA

    Written by Jeremy Lawrence
    July 17, 2009 – 10:41 am


    carta busUp to 1/5th of workers at the new VW plant could ride CARTA buses to work.That from CARTA’s executive director Tom Dugan, who said their buses will run right to the door of the new facility.

    Dugan noted that the parking lot for the new facility is huge and said that workers that are the last to arrive could spend half an hour just walking to the door from their vehicle.

    Meanwhile, CARTA has received 5 new buses and are making plans to redo some routes to accommodate the new vehicles, because they are so large.
